This documentation (tutorial to run the workflow) explains how to run a workflow that belongs to the pack with same name.The Life Table Response Experiments Effect of Years in One Place workflow provides an environment to analyse two or more matrices from different years in one location. The objective of this workflow is to determine the effects of the research years (2 or more) in one place on λ. This documentation (tutorial to run the workflow) explains how to run a workflow that belongs to the pack with same name.The Parametric Bootstrap or Resample a projection matrix Workflow provides an environment to resample a projection matrix using a multinomial distribution for transitions and a log normal distribution for fertilities (Stubben, Milligan, and Nantel. 2011).
